Shower room floor covering
Try to avoid the urge to position carpetings on the bathroom floor, according to the survey it is not as well favoured. The study revealed that the recommended flooring covering was floor tiles, with 75 per cent saying they "loved" a tiled bathroom floor. Popular vinyl floor covering has actually not yet shed its area in the shower room, with greater than 61 per cent saying they didn't have any kind of solid likes or dislikes towards it.
When picking your shower room flooring, tiles is the favoured alternative, however if the budget plan is limited, then plastic floor covering will not let you down.
Aside from the flooring, make certain your home windows look appealing. When it pertains to clothing your washroom home windows, stay away from those washroom webs and also textile drapes. The study showed that 94 per cent said they favoured blinds in the washroom to curtains.
Shower power
When intending the layout of your washroom, one of one of the most crucial facets to take into consideration is putting a shower. Some washrooms don't have adequate space to consist of a shower workstation, so evaluate your choices. Think about mounting a shower over the bathroom if room is restricted.
The study revealed that 94 per cent of its participants believed that a shower in a restroom was very important, and 81 percent claimed they liked a separate shower enclosure in a huge washroom. Virtually 65 per cent said their perfect would be a power shower, while 27 per cent favored mixer showers, as well as only 12 percent chose electrical showers.
If you have picked a shower over the bath, after that consider placing a set glass screen rather than a shower drape. It might cost a few added pounds, but over half of the study's factors preferred a fixed glass display to a shower drape.
Choosing your bath tub
In contrast to usual idea, adding a whirlpool bath to boost residential or commercial property worth doesn't always work. So if you're contemplating selling your building, attempt to stay clear of acquiring a whirlpool bath in the hopes of obtaining added earnings.
The study disclosed that near to 53 per cent of its participants were not phased by them, while only a tiny 38 percent of participants "loved" them. Surprisingly, 62 percent stated they had "no strong sight" in the direction of corner baths either, which suggests the standard rectangular bathrooms still hold clout versus their fixed up counter components.
Hello simpleness
From as far back as the 1960s much emphasis was placed on strong colour in the bathroom. Patterned wall surface tiles of nautical animals and also over-the-top colours were the pattern, in addition to plastic. Plastic washroom decoration was the trend, from vibrant orange, olive environment-friendly, mustard yellow and chocolate brown coloured toothbrush, soap as well as towel holders, to thick patterned plastic shower curtains that shrieked colours of the boldest nature.
As the moments went on, the 1970s and also very early 1980s came to be a duration when gold washroom fixings and furnishing, such as faucets, towel rails and also toilet roll holders, were thought about really elegant. These over the top gold trimmed attributes were in vogue, and shower room design was 'loud'. Included in this were those when wonderful bathroom collections in colours avocado, coral reefs pink, and delicious chocolate brownish. Restroom colour has actually altered drastically over the past decade, and also shades have actually become extra neutral, often with a tip of colour that adds a corresponding vigour to the overall plan.
Of the many hundreds of people that took part in Plumbworld's recent washroom survey, an overwhelming 82 percent said they "disliked" the as soon as glorified avocado and coral reefs pink washroom suites, colours remnant of 1970s as well as 1980s, which are commonly qualified as being dark and dull.
According to the survey, chrome restroom taps were much liked to gold.
So, when creating and also enhancing your washroom maintain those dark colours away, think about white collections, as well as choose chrome mendings as well as furnishings instead of flashy gold.

The 5 Benefits Of Renovating Your Bathroom
Looking for simple renovations that will give your home a face lift? Start with your bathroom, especially if you have pink tile and a baby blue toilet. Outdated bathrooms can stop potential buyers in their tracks. Even if you're not looking to sell, it's nice to feel like you're living in the current decade. Besides increasing the value of your home, the bathroom can be a place to get creative and have some fun. Here are five major benefits a bathroom re-do can offer:
Increase your home's value
According to HGTV.com, a minor bathroom remodel gives you a 102% return at resale. A minor remodel encompasses replacing the tub, tile surround, floor, toilet, sink, vanity, and fixtures, then perhaps finishing off the project with a fresh coat of paint on the walls. As you renovate, keep in mind the color and decorating trends of today and if those trends will have lasting value in the future.
Save money now
Replacing leaky faucets, adding aerators, and installing an on-demand water heater and a water-efficient toilet will save you big bucks on utility costs.
Become a more peaceful oasis
Performing your daily ablutions in a messy, unattractive space with old, substandard fixtures can be a source of stress. With a renovation, you can unwind in a claw-foot tub and dry off afterwards with heated towels. You can choose colors and textures that will help you relax and soothe stress away, taking you to your happy place.
Reduce clutter
Poorly designed bathrooms invite clutter, so when you renovate you can increase storage capacity with the smart designs available in today's cabinetry. You can finally find discreet homes for your towels, cleaners, toiletries, and medicines.
Become more eco-friendly
You can reclaim and repurpose an older porcelain sink, saving it from a landfill. Or you can buy new fixtures and materials from companies developing products that are energy-efficient, low-tox, biodegradable, and/or recyclable.
